Adopting cloud technology to enhance experience, productivi­ty and process efficiency for a team of insurance sellers and distributo­rs

- PCQ Bureau

As part of the initiative, ABSLI has implemente­d Virtual Desktops on Microsoft Azure cloud for 1,400 members of its sales team, at over 100 branch locations across India. This initiative is enhancing customer acquisitio­n and revenue generation for ABSLI. ABSLI has been operating for nearly two decades, and has developed an extensive network of branches and partner agents. Adoption of Virtual Desktops on Azure cloud has reduced the capital expenditur­e involved in hardware refresh of a distribute­d IT infrastruc­ture, reduced usage costs as the Virtual Desktops are on a pay-as-you-use model and enabled availabili­ty of infrastruc­ture during seasonal business spikes. It has also enabled ABSLI sales force to access data and applicatio­ns across branch locations seamlessly, thereby improving enduser experience and productivi­ty. The replacemen­t of old desktops with virtual desktops has also led to power savings.

Virtual Desktop

The Virtual Desktop, also referred to as Desktopas-a-Service, solution has been implemente­d by Microsoft partner, Anunta. The solution has been designed for 1,400 users and 1,000 end-points. It includes Citrix Xen Desktop and Firewall implementa­tion, data and Office 365 migration, peripheral integratio­n, monitoring and management of complete VDI ( Virtual Desktop Integratio­n) stack in the Azure environmen­t. ABSLI is now planning to rollout this solution for its entire sales team, across India.
